The name for AlCl3 in the ionic form is aluminum chloride. It typically forms ionic compounds with a 3+ charge on the aluminum cation and a 1- charge on the chloride anion.

What is the correct formula for the combination of an aluminum ion and a chloride ion that form the ionic compound aluminum chloride?

The correct formula for aluminum chloride is AlCl3. This is because aluminum typically forms a 3+ ion (Al3+) and chloride forms a 1- ion (Cl-), so three chloride ions are needed to balance the charge of one aluminum ion in the compound.

Calculate the number of formula units of the compound and the number of each ion in 6.75 moles of AlCl3?

In 6.75 moles of AlCl3, there are 6.75 times Avogadro's number of formula units, which is approximately 4.07 x 10^24 formula units. Each formula unit of AlCl3 contains one Al^3+ ion and three Cl^- ions. Therefore, in 6.75 moles of AlCl3, there are also 4.07 x 10^24 Al^3+ ions and 1.22 x 10^25 Cl^- ions.


The charge on a chloride ion in alcl3 is what?

The charge on a chloride ion in any ionic compound is -1. AlCl3 is usually considered an ionic compound, although it has some covalent character in its bonds also. If the compound is considered covalent, the characteristic number for a particular atom within the compound is usually called "oxidation number" or sometimes "formal charge" instead of simply "charge", but that is also -1.

How many molecules does alcl3 dissociate into?

1 mole of AlCl3 will dissociate into 4 moles of ions in aqueous solution: 1 mole of Al+3 ions and 3 moles of Cl- ions.
